Transaction 634faa88c8a3e5abd56a8367151b8ff7cc631ef04174a83d7d3a72d0820ee554
1 Input
1 Output
-
634faa88c8a3e5abd56a8367151b8ff7cc631ef04174a83d7d3a72d0820ee554:0
- value
- 118856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 250a74e622540c2b3a7e19402c51c18fb59449fb OP_EQUAL
- address
- 354sTBUENTY5NSrcVjxyFigKJMMWqq4eJH